Elements Impacting Surety Efficiency Bond Expenses



You should take into consideration several elements that can affect the cost of guaranty performance bonds for your company.

The first variable is the bond quantity. Normally, the greater the bond quantity, the greater the price of the bond.

One more aspect is the monetary standing of your company. If your business has a strong financial performance history and good debt, you may be able to secure a lower bond expense.

In addition, the type of task or contract can affect the bond cost. Higher-risk projects might call for a higher bond costs.

The period of the bond likewise plays a role in its price. Longer-term bonds generally have greater premiums.

Lastly, the guaranty business you select can impact the bond expense. Different guaranty companies have various rates and underwriting criteria.

Evaluating the Threat Profile for Bond Rates



When evaluating the threat profile for bond pricing, think about variables such as the task's intricacy and the service provider's experience. These 2 factors play an important role in determining the degree of threat related to the project and, as a result, the price of the performance bond.

A complicated job with complex design demands and tight target dates poses a higher danger for the guaranty company. In a similar way, a specialist with limited experience in handling similar tasks might be considered greater threat also.

Other aspects that may affect bond pricing include the economic stability of the professional, the job's place, and the schedule of subcontractors.
